For me personally, seems a more durable/longer lasting better finish? I'm no expert at all and hopefully someone can correct me if wrong, but both my sets of wheels are powder coated and very very pleased with the finish I have. Had a painted set on my old Civic Type-R and seemed to chip easily? That could of course be down to a rubbish finish, was done by previous owner so can't say for sure.
 
Powder coat would be better than a rattle can job, but so would a pro painted finish. I think factory finish is paint so it must be good wearing. Paint works on centre caps too, and f. me the powder on my wheels is so thick I can't read any of the cast writing!
